§ 155.073 AREA REGULATIONS.
   (A)   Front yard. There shall be a front yard having a depth from the center of the road of not less than: 70 feet if on a village highway; 100 feet if on a county highway; and 175 feet if on a state highway.
      (1)   Where lots have a double frontage, the required front yard shall be provided on both streets.
      (2)   Where a lot is located at the intersection of two or more streets there shall be a front yard on each street side of a corner lot; provided, however, that the buildable width of a lot of record need not be reduced to less than 50 feet, except where necessary to provide a yard along the side street with a depth of not less than 20 feet. No accessory building shall project beyond the front yard line on either street.
   (B)   Side yard. Except as provided in § 155.162, there shall be a side yard on each side of a building having a width of not less than 20 feet or 15% of the average width of the lot, whichever amount is smaller; provided that no side yard shall have a width of less than ten feet.
   (C)   Rear yard. Except as hereinafter provided in § 155.162, there shall be a rear yard having a depth of not less than 50 feet or 30% of the depth of the lot, whichever amount is smaller.
